Transaction c59ed4ca800b2d02647690472be1af9fc371b40ae56776b252eb60ce606362f2
1 Input
1 Output
-
c59ed4ca800b2d02647690472be1af9fc371b40ae56776b252eb60ce606362f2:0
- value
- 509189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44e91311d2eb08404c21a9d8f605f0af68c88433 OP_EQUAL
- address
- 37yP5tScvpFxa5MTGTB5j7eCLQrRxeJq8x